Several companies provide the necessary technology and interpreters to allow everyone to be able to communicate, and it is important that each ofthese companies adhere to basic guidelines to ensure competent service. I am happy that the Federal Communications Commission has created a certification process to make sure that VRS companies are able to provide quality service to customers. However, Convo Communications, a company with employees and consumers in our districts, applied for certification from the Commission in October 2009, but its application has still not been processed. The FCC has informed us that the certification process has come under scrutiny following the discovery that several unscrupulous companies were improperly taking advantage ofthe system, and we appreciate your commitment to protecting consumers. However, we are concerned about the length of time that Convo's application has been pending. We urge you to process Convo Communications' application in a fair and timely manner. Delaying certification hinders the company's ability to efficiently run a business, and certification delays for good companies ultimately prove detrimental to customers who depend on VRS. The FCC has played a significant role supporting Americans with disabilities. We request that you inform us ofthe progress ofConvo Communications' application at the earliest opportunity.
